Police Investigate Shooting Following Road Rage Incident in Hingham
A victim was transported to a local hospital with injuries after an altercation on Route 228 escalated into a shooting in a public library parking lot.
- A road rage altercation on Route 228 escalated into a shooting in the Hingham Public Library parking lot.
- One person was hospitalized with injuries following the discharge of a firearm.
- Hingham police are actively investigating the incident and have not yet released the identities of those involved.
- Authorities continue to urge drivers to avoid confrontations and contact emergency services when faced with aggressive behavior.
An Escalation of Hostility
A routine commute turned violent in Hingham on Thursday, as authorities reported that a road rage incident culminated in a shooting that left one person hospitalized. The confrontation, which unfolded across the town’s roadways before concluding in a municipal parking lot, prompted an immediate police response and a search for the individuals involved.
According to reports from multiple outlets, including WCVB and Boston 25 News, the incident took place on Route 228. Investigators stated that the dispute between drivers escalated until a firearm was discharged, resulting in injuries to one of the participants. The wounded individual was subsequently transported to a medical facility for treatment. While the exact nature and severity of the injuries have not been disclosed, the incident has drawn significant attention due to its occurrence in a high-traffic public area.
The Sequence of Events
The situation reached its climax at the Hingham Public Library, where the suspect reportedly fired a weapon at the other driver, as noted by MassLive. Local law enforcement officials have confirmed that the exchange began as a vehicular dispute elsewhere on the road before the parties arrived at the library grounds.
The proximity of the violence to a public facility has heightened concerns among local residents and town officials. While police have not released the identities of those involved, they have initiated a comprehensive investigation into the circumstances surrounding the shooting. As of Friday, July 24, 2026, authorities continue to process evidence gathered from the scene and are reviewing potential witness accounts to piece together the events that led a minor traffic disagreement to result in gunfire.
Why This Matters: The Rising Toll of Road Rage
The Hingham incident serves as a stark reminder of the escalating volatility seen on regional roadways. Road rage—defined by aggressive, hostile, or violent behavior by a driver—has increasingly moved beyond verbal altercations and gestures to include the brandishing of weapons and physical violence.
Sociologists and traffic safety experts often point to a confluence of factors that contribute to these incidents, including increased traffic congestion, personal stress, and a general decline in civility during commute times. When a dispute moves from a public roadway into a stationary environment like a library parking lot, it underscores the difficulty law enforcement faces in preempting these outbursts. For the public, these incidents highlight the inherent risks of engaging with aggressive drivers, as even minor perceived slights can lead to life-altering violence.

Law enforcement agencies have consistently advised that the best defense against road rage is avoidance. Officials frequently urge drivers to refrain from eye contact, avoid making provocative gestures, and to contact police if they feel they are being pursued, rather than attempting to engage or confront the other driver directly.
